Located a five-minute walk from Legian Beach, Legian Village Hotel was recently refurbished and provides modern rooms featuring a mini bar, a private balcony and bottled water. It also offers a coffee bar, free Wi-Fi and a kids pool.
This relaxed hotel provides a car rental desk, bicycle rental and a hair salon. The on-site spa offers a variety of treatments and a chance to relax.
Legian Village Hotel features 110 air conditioned rooms. There is also a desk and an in-room closet.
Enjoy a relaxing pre-dinner drink in the hotel's comfortable lounge bar, before heading off to the restaurant for an evening meal. Alternatively, the surrounding area features several bars and restaurants serving a choice of different cuisines.
Legian's attractions, such as Padang Padang Beach, Melasti Beach Resort Spa and Glow Spa at Bali Mandira, are within easy walking distance of Legian Village Hotel. Kuta is within a 10-minute walk of the hotel.

Opt for a Room in the Second Building
Guests recommended staying in the second building for a serene and spacious experience with inspiring architecture.
Consider Room Renovations
Some guests suggested choosing renovated rooms for a more comfortable and updated stay, as older rooms were described as poor and in need of maintenance.
Check for Balcony Access
If having a balcony is important, ensure that the room selected includes this feature, as some guests were disappointed by the lack of a balcony.
Be Mindful of Noise
While the location is convenient, some guests noted that the hotel can be noisy, so light sleepers may want to prepare accordingly.
Request Room Changes if Necessary
Don't hesitate to ask for a room change if the initial room does not meet expectations, as some guests reported issues with the quality of certain rooms.
Take Advantage of the Spa
Guests spoke highly of the on-site spa, recommending it as a relaxing retreat and a chance to unwind during the stay.
Consider the Pool Area
The pool was highlighted as a great feature, but some guests mentioned that it could be improved, so it's worth checking recent reviews for the latest feedback on the pool conditions.
Be Aware of Bathroom Conditions
Several guests mentioned that the bathrooms could use updating and thorough cleaning, so it's helpful to manage expectations in this regard.
Check for Room Comfort
Some guests found the beds to be quite firm, so if a softer bed is preferred, it may be worth inquiring about options for added comfort.
Be Prepared for Noise from Surrounding Establishments
Guests noted that the hotel's proximity to bars and restaurants could result in some noise, particularly in certain rooms, so it's advisable to consider this when selecting a room.
